Research Scientist: Physical/Geological Data Scientist, Geologist, or Physical Oceanographer

The Institute’s Applied Geosciences Program is looking to recruit top scientists in fields related to geological data science; fluvial, deltaic, and coastal geomorphology and processes; regional sediment management; Quaternary geology; numerical modeling (physics-based and machine learning); and high-resolution shallow stratigraphy with applications to resource management.

Position Description

The Water Institute of the Gulf is seeking research geological data scientists, geologists, and/or physical oceanographers at various career levels to join a growing team of interdisciplinary scientists conducting research to develop and apply novel decision support technical tools to inform coastal, river, and natural resource management. These positions report to the Director of Applied Geosciences.
 
Roles and Responsibilities:
·        Initiates, conducts, and publishes original research, typically requiring creativity and modification to existing procedures, methods, applications, and techniques, and develops entirely new approaches to address novel or specialized problems for which existing methods are not substantially applicable.  
·        Develops and nurtures relationships with scientific peers across disciplines, partners and collaborators, potential clients, decision makers, and end users to advance science and its applications, obtain new projects, and expand the Applied Geosciences program portfolio of original science products, decision support tools, and interdisciplinary collaborators.
·        Actively pursues external funding to support research activities.
·        Develops collaborative, interdisciplinary projects with colleagues within The Institute and other research organizations.
·        For more senior research scientists: Represents an authoritative source for consultation by other scientists and managers and is tasked with the responsibility of assisting or leading the design of and implementing research programs aimed to resolve complicated, controversial, and multidisciplinary issues that have broad impacts to informing public policy and management decisions.
